<title>Abstract</title> <p>Conversion of sputum from positive to negative is one of the indicators of intensive phase treatment of pulmonary tuberculosis. We analyzed the sputum conversion of 1782 patients diagnosed sputum-positive pulmonary tuberculosis in Beijing between 2021–2022 and designed a case-matched study including 24 pairs of delayed and timely sputum-conversion patients.
